When it comes to planning your big day, picking out wedding flowers is one of the more enjoyable tasks. As you’re choosing blooms, remember that there are several other guests whom you should supply with boutonnieres for the ceremony.

3 Wedding Guests Who Deserve Flowers

1. Parents 

Although it’s ultimately the couple’s special day, their parents will undoubtedly play a major role in both the ceremony and the reception. They’ll also appear in a considerable number of photographs. And if they have their own floral arrangements, it will only add to the aesthetic of these images. 

2. Grandparents 

wedding flowersAny grandparents in attendance deserve their own flowers. This is a big day for them, too, and giving each a bouquet or boutonniere will let them know just how much you appreciate their attendance, especially if it was a bit of a trek for them. You can be sure they’ll be honored you thought of them amid all the chaos of wedding planning. 

3. Guests Who Are Participating 

If any of your guests are participating in the big day, giving them flowers will both show your gratitude and let others know who you’ve designated for help. For example, you can give corsages and boutonnieres to those who are handing out programs, serving as ushers, singing during the ceremony, or performing other essential tasks before, during, or after your wedding.
